    For solve 1 there was a PLL skip possibility, but it probably wasn’t possible to see. If you do the cross the same but don’t insert the orange cross piece, then do the first two pairs the same, you can do a U2 before inserting the final cross piece, and pair up the orange-green pair. After inserting amd solving last slot, the OLL is just a back wide antisune, with a PLL skip

    When you really think about it this average was kinda a fail ngl
    So on the fourth solve had he inserted the third pair with L' U2 L he would've ended up with a 57 move solution, and with the 9.37 tps it would have been a 6.08
    On the fifth solve, I found a better solution where you do the XCross as R' U D' R2 U2 R u' and then do green-red with R U R' hedge, then the green-orange like normal and the green-blue like normal and then ll cancelling into the jperm gives you a 50 move solution and we can assume that with this slightly more fingertrick-friendly solution he could've hit around 11 tps giving us a 4.54
    This leaves us with 4.97, 6.20, (7.35), 6.08, (4.54)=5.75 average
    And even with the 10.58 tps on solve five its the same average because its still a 4.72
